PSL squad Lahore Qalandars appoints Aqib Javed as coach

| @indiablooms | Dec 27, 2017, at 09:31 pm

Lahore Dec 27 (IBNS); Pakistan Super League (PSL) franchise Lahore Qalandars has appointed former pacer Aqib Javed as coach.

Pakistan cricketer Fakhar Zaman as been name the vice captain of the squad for the upcoming season of the tournament.

The official Twitter handle of the team said: "The announcement you all have been waiting for! Join us in welcoming @AJavedOfficial as our #SupremeQalandar, someone who's already been putting in efforts day and night for the team as our Director Cricket Operations."

Atiq-uz-Zaman will join the squad as the fielding coach while Kabir Khan will serve as the assistant coach of the team.
